- Summary:
- Dubai's Sheikhs have claimed it's the eighth wonder of the world and, seen from space, the tree-shaped sand and rock formation of the Palm Jumeirah looks exactly that. It's just one of the amazing man-made structures that has turned Dubai into the fastest growing place on earth. It has the most luxurious hotel in the world, the tallest building on Earth, the world's biggest airport, a covered ski slope in the middle of the desert and an enormous theme park. But the most ambitious project is the building of an aritificial archipelago whose islands have been sculptured to form various shapes - a palm tree, a world map, a half moon. Building these islands will increase the Emirate's coastline from 70-kilometres to over 1,000. Dubai's property speculation and building fever is astonishing.
